Film historian and acclaimed New York Times bestselling biographer Scott Eyman has written the definitive biography of Hollywood icon Joan Crawford, drawing on never-before-seen documents and photos from the Crawford estate. Joan Crawford flourished for decades, working for multiple studios in every genre from romance to westerns ("Mildred Pierce," "Johnny Guitar"), musicals to noir ("Torch Song," "A Woman's Face"), and being directed by a young Steven Spielberg in one of her last appearances. Once a niche medical procedure, egg freezing is now a billion-dollar industry that promises women the ability to pause their biological clocks and extend their reproductive choices. For some, it's a path to empowerment; for others, it's a costly gamble in an unregulated system with no guarantees. Through the experiences of three American women navigating the process, this documentary examines the realities behind the growing trend—who has access, who profits, and what's at stake. The extraordinary Craig Carnelia has had four shows produced on Broadway. Working with composer Marvin Hamlisch, he wrote the lyrics for "Sweet Smell of Success," with book by John Guare, and "Imaginary Friends" with Nora Ephron.

As both composer and lyricist, Craig wrote the score for "Is There Life After High School" and contributed songs to "Working."
